Output e64a570590616e25260d442088ec5eeb6bbd37e9887882dbadb5616701115033:0

value
40674755
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e09573c6bdbe95b02c1866557460ec646325d67 OP_EQUALVERIFY OP_CHECKSIG
address
13jpTmEhJuYrBgAVEtsqmWmvQP1iFiZZaa
transaction
e64a570590616e25260d442088ec5eeb6bbd37e9887882dbadb5616701115033
spent
true